Mental Health Awareness Marked in 2015

Bringing mental illness out of the shadows has long been a goal of the mental health community. In 2015, this movement caught steam as both famous and non-famous sufferers shared their stories publically. The Mighty, a website devoted to educating people about all mental illnesses, lists nine people as 2015 Mighty Mental Health Heroes:


  • Erin Jones, a young woman who inspired people to post mental health selfies: “I have always been open about my life, because being honest and vulnerable shows others that they aren’t alone.”

  • Kate Middleton, British royal: It is our duty, as parents and as teachers, to give all children the space to build their emotional strength and provide a strong foundation for their future.”

  • Brandon Marshall, NFL player: “One of the bravest things I’ve done is talk about my borderline personality disorder.”

  • Tim Murphy, member of the U.S. House of Representatives: “Our broken system does not respond until after a crisis, when we could be doing something to stop it from happening.”

  • Dwayne “The Rock” Johnson, actor: “I found that with depression one of the most important things you could realize is that you’re not alone.”

  • Ali Mattu, psychologist: “Psychology saves lives....[and] uses science to help humanity move forward.”

  • Demi Lovato, singer, who represented  Be Vocal: Speak Up for Mental Health in her remarks to legislators on Capitol Hill: “I want to show the world that there is life—surprising, wonderful and unexpected life after diagnosis.”

  • Patrick J. Kennedy, former member of the U.S. House of Representatives and author of a memoir revealing his famous family’s struggles—“No one is immune from addiction; it afflicts people of all ages, races, classes and professions.”

  • Vikram Patel, psychiatrist: “Spare a thought for that person you thought about who has a mental illness, or persons that you thought about who have mental illness, and dare to care for them.”
